W.P.NO.1541/2019.

Heard.

The revision filed by the petitioner under Section 70A of the Maharashtra Public Trusts Act, 1950 is dismissed by the learned Joint Charity Commissioner by the impugned order. The learned Joint Charity Commissioner has recorded that along with the change report, the reporting trustee had filed "no objection" of outgoing trustees, Consent Letter of incoming trustees, copy of the notice of meeting of the executive Committee and minutes of meeting of the executive Committee dated 1st April 2011, copy of notice of meeting of the general body and minutes of meeting of the general body

2 wp1541.19 dated 2nd April, 2012. The learned Joint Charity Commissioner has observed that the petitioner had also signed the document by which "no objection" was given by the outgoing trustees.

The learned Joint Charity Commissioner has observed that the petitioner had also filed an affidavit before the Assistant Charity Commissioner in support of the change report. This fact has weighed with the learned Joint Charity Commissioner while passing the impugned order. According to the petitioner, he was not aware about the proceedings before the Joint Charity Commissioner and has not sworn any affidavit in support of the change report.

The petitioner has filed an additional affidavit sworn on 28th February 2019 stating that he was not aware about the proceedings before the Assistant Charity Commissioner and he has not sworn the affidavit as recorded in the impugned order.
